Abstract:
The present application relates to a curable composition, a cured body, and uses of the curable composition and the cured body. The present application can provide a curable composition, which, by containing a curable compound having a particular structure, can enhance the cohesive strength of a cured material without an increase in the viscosity of the composition before curing, minimize an increase in the elastic modulus of the cured material, improve the interfacial adhesive strength, and minimize the proportion of non-reactive oligomers. The curable composition can be applied to various optical uses, and for example, the curable composition can be advantageously used for direct bonding of various optical functional members of a display device, such as direct bonding between a touch panel and a display panel.
